About The Position

Process and certify new and existing applications for the Fuel Assistance, Energy, and associated programs in accordance with federal and state funding requirements and SMOC policies and procedures. The program is seasonal and there is moratorium on usage of time-off during the period of November 15 to March 15 each year.

Responsibilities

  • Review/process new applications and re-certs (ARF’s) to determine eligibility/ineligibility in accordance with state policies/regulations and within prescribed state time frames.
  • Interview clients and collect new applications.
  • Enter applicable information into the computer system.
  • Gather required forms and documentation; maintain client file.
  • Review and process all information for completeness to meet program requirements/guidelines.
  • Process incomplete/denial letters for clients in accordance to state policies.
  • Process and send vendor and client notices.
  • Make home visits if necessary.
  • Respond to client inquiries via telephone; refer clients as appropriate.
  • Provide coverage for the front desk receptionist as needed.
  • Attend & participate in scheduled state meetings as well as in outreach activities.
  • Engage all clients by understanding and addressing their needs whether within or outside the scope of work.
  • Attend & participate in team meetings as requested and communicate effectively with clients and staff in other areas.
  • Maintain confidentiality of client, employee and agency information in accordance with federal and state laws and funder requirements.
  • Ensure compliance with program/department, agency and/or funder requirements, as well as, SMOC policies & procedures.
